Chiltern took out all the hopper windows when they installed similar kit on the 165/0s, a system that has been pretty much bombproof since day one, so really can't see why GWR would do anything different.

The Chiltern sytem uses 4 separate air cooling units per coach, so even if there is a failure it will only tend to affect part of a coach. The down side is it uses up quite a lot of the former luggage rack space.

From the picture it's not too clear. Given that it's been fitted with new air conditioning, it may well extend across the top of the entire train.

For the umpteenth time, the 165/1s, like the Chiltern 165/0s, are being fitted with air cooling - which is not air conditioning.

In basic terms, air cooling does what it says on the tin - cools the air. Air conditioning systems also dehumidify the air.

The crash repair contract probably called for the damaged car to be returned to the condition it was running in at the time it derailed, so that would be a full-length white roof.

Green paint will have to wait until it is 165124's turn to go to Wolverton.
